coBoost engine technology is a remarkable innovation by Ford Australia that has surprised all and sundry including the cynics.... Whereas the technology delivers improved fuel economy, its power output is derived from the conventional petrol engine.... Another crucial technology in EcoBoost engine is turbocharging, which utilises the exhaust gases of the engine so as to push air that is more highly compressed into the engine.... lectronic Stability Control (ESC) was adopted and implemented by Ford Australia as an innovative technology for safety driving....
